How Long Does It Actually Take?
Real timelines for Montgomery County — not what the county website says, but what permit applicants actually experience.
| Project Type | Typical Timeline |
|---|---|
| Simple residential (remodel, deck, fence) | 2–6 weeks |
| Addition or structural renovation | 6–14 weeks |
| New construction | 3–6 months |
| Commercial / multifamily | 6–12+ months |
The truth:
These timelines assume a complete, correct submission on the first try. Most applicants experience 2–4 revision cycles that multiply total time by 2–3x. Montgomery County requires separate reviews from DPS, DEP, and sometimes SHA. Forest conservation and impervious surface rules are strictly enforced.
Why Permits Get Delayed in Montgomery County
The three most common reasons applicants end up in revision cycles
Forest Conservation Compliance
State-mandated forest conservation reviews add significant time and require coordinated documentation.
Zoning Overlay District Conflicts
Montgomery has numerous overlay districts with unique requirements that frequently conflict with base zoning.
Multiple Agency Sign-Offs
DPS, DEP, and SHA reviews must be coordinated simultaneously — a single missing approval holds the entire permit.
